Transaction 2790923126007e295b91b8c011b1881d9a803f159ca82b8a2f05a857d3b85f04
1 Input
1 Output
-
2790923126007e295b91b8c011b1881d9a803f159ca82b8a2f05a857d3b85f04:0
- value
- 13805983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0f027f89071efcef99b17d0161fda98957a21ff OP_EQUAL
- address
- MUQXHjwK9ubtoenT8hg4mYB9F1zbDG29VK